Most Ontario parents start their childcare search the same way: joining waitlists, searching government directories, and getting put on hold. These approaches were designed for long-term enrollment placement, not for finding a licensed daycare opening this month or this week.
Waitlists for infant care in Ontario can run four years or longer. Government directories show which centres are licensed and which participate in CWELCC, but not which ones have openings available today. The information gap is enormous and it costs families their jobs and their savings.
